Theosophy against Racism
(Written in private Nov. 7th 2002 by Morten Nymann)


During several centuries there has been clashes between cultures on this planet called Earth. On our Earth there has been people living with different colours of skin. Differences as such has for years divided people into different groupings. If people "belonged" to a certain kind of skin-colour they thought they were sort of among equals when they came across one with the same colour.
Today in our informations society with fast transportation aeroplanes, cars etc. we have the present day cultures clashing with their differences so to speak. Yes. There are still a lot of poor people on this planet. But anyway that is what is going on at the moment.
Because of these cultural exchanges and the fast transportation etc. the differences between cultures become more and more visible.

Theosophy are also called The Ancient Wisdom teaching of all ages past. Some theosophical groupings are today to a certain degree building their teaching on the books written by woman called H. P. Blavatsky (d.1891). The one who wrote the famous book called The Secret Doctrine and other important books on the Ancient Wisdom Teachings.

Sometimes books and scriptures on the Ancient Wisdoms Teaching were made to a certain group of people or a certain audience. They were made at a certain time and place in history. The use of words and their meaning at that time was one and at another time it will be different or is different.
One could say, that almost anything written in for instance the 1800's or even earlier would be colored by the culture of the time. Popular prejudices and misconceptions would be ingrained in the language, writing, and manner of speech that people used then. From a different standpoint, we can look back and see things of which the people of the time may not have been aware.
If someone today reads an older book, the biases of its time will show up. It is not particular to true theosophical books. If we want something to appear as unbiased, we need to write something new that communicates the philosophy in modern terms. Even with that, later generations will look back on anything that we write in the 2000's as being biased in ways we do not currently realize, just as we do so upon the writings of for instance the 1800's.

The use of words in various theosophical scriptures - and especially those of H. P. Blavatsky - those words like 'races', 'root-races' etc. had a different meaning at the time of writing than they have today. Then it was quite common to be a racist in United Kingdom, Germany or another country. So to make scriptures attractive and giving to people at that time one would have to use a certain vocabulary - and veiling the teaching of wisdom. The use of the word or term "race" or "root-race" refers in the book "The Secret Doctrine" by H. P. Blavatsky obviously to a karmical konditioned group of people, and not necessarily to the color of their skin or the culture they lived in or live in, and neither which religion they have or had. This seem pretty clear when reading the following pages: Secret Doctrine Vol. II, p. 130, 200, 248-250, and 471. Especially p. 249 footnote.
We also have to remember, that Blavatsky only promised that her book The Secret Doctrine would last for about a 100 years - and then better books or scriptures would surface.  the question is when they will come? Because we are now about 14 years past that date.

And when this is said, we also will have to remember, that Theosophy as such has - no - i.e. NO Bibles at all. To think so is to misunderstand what Theosophy represents. There are really no main books to read. Each group are free to chose their own - main - books if any at all. The importance is here, that if any main books are chosen - then they should be following the Wisdom Teaching of all ages past.
The various groups often makes certain, that they at least are not in any real opposition to the famous book The secret Doctrine. But as we have seen, that book is slowly getting older and older.

It is very important that one understand, that Theosophy is a teaching AGAINST racism and all what it covers. But even so Theosophy as such has to relate to the reality on this Planet. The reality is, that some people are born with one colour of skin and other people with another. And that there is a certain reason for that.
And because of this they to a certain degree - even today year 2002 -  have a different background to develop - spiritually from. The importance of this physical issue will quickly vanish because of our present informations society - with fast transportation and fast communication. (At 1888 the picture was different than today).
But as time goes by the physical part of us - the humans - will be of lesser importance. The importance will then be, as it also already is now, on the character of the individual - and its patterns of emotional reactions and mental behaviour, the so-called Kama-Manas.
The use of one or more of the so-called 7 keys (as mentioned by H. P. Blavatsky in her book The Secret Doctrine) was necessary to use, to a certain degree, so to make the books more living and giving to the audience at that time.
